The prophet Nahum reminds us of three essential truths about the goodness of God.

Nahum 1:7 (NKJV) “The Lord is good, A stronghold in the day of trouble; And He knows those who trust in Him.”

First, God is good! 

This is the battlefield right here. Your daily spiritual, mental, and emotional health are all tied up in this, “Do you believe it?” You must have this basic fact solidified in your relationship with God.

Jeremiah 29:11–12 (NLT) “For I know the plans I have for you,” says the Lord. “They are plans for good and not for disaster, to give you a future and a hope. In those days when you pray, I will listen.”

Next, God is a stronghold in the day of trouble. 

Just because God is good doesn’t mean you won’t face problems. No! Troubles come to us all. None of us are immune. God doesn’t promise to keep you from trials but rather support, protect, and deliver you! God is a stronghold like no one else!

Proverbs 18:10 (NLT) “The name of the Lord is a strong fortress; the godly run to him and are safe.”

Finally, God knows those who trust in Him. 

He has promised to sustain those who look to Him! Of course, you feel like you have no trust in difficult times. But God knows you trust in HIm, even in the struggle.

Psalm 55:22 (NLT) “Give your burdens to the Lord, and he will take care of you. He will not permit the godly to slip and fall.”
